Sun Jan 12 06:43:27 UTC 2025: ## Shami Returns, Surprises in India’s T20 Squad for England Series

**Mumbai, India** – Veteran pacer Mohammed Shami has made a triumphant return to the Indian cricket team for the upcoming five-match T20I series against England, starting January 22nd. Shami’s inclusion follows a period of recovery from injuries, including ankle surgery, which kept him out of action since the ODI World Cup final in November. His selection is seen as a strong indication of his place in contention for the Champions Trophy squad.

However, the squad announcement also brought some surprises. Rishabh Pant’s omission from the T20I team, led by Suryakumar Yadav, remains unexplained by the BCCI. Dhruv Jurel and Sanju Samson will serve as wicket-keepers. Another notable absence is all-rounder Shivam Dube, while Nitish Kumar Reddy earns a spot.

The pace attack will rely on Shami, Harshit Rana, and Arshdeep Singh, while the spin department features Varun Chakaravarthy, Ravi Bishnoi, and Washington Sundar. The batting lineup boasts a mix of experience and emerging talent, including Suryakumar Yadav, Abhishek Sharma, Tilak Varma, Hardik Pandya, and Rinku Singh.

The BCCI’s decision to include Shami is a significant boost for India’s chances in the upcoming series, especially following their recent setbacks in the Border Gavaskar Trophy. The team will be keen to demonstrate their strength ahead of the ICC Champions Trophy. The board has reportedly requested an extension from the ICC for the Champions Trophy squad announcement, suggesting further deliberations are underway.

**India’s T20I squad for England:** Suryakumar Yadav (C), Sanju Samson (wk), Abhishek Sharma, Tilak Varma, Hardik Pandya, Rinku Singh, Nitish Kumar Reddy, Axar Patel (vc), Harshit Rana, Arshdeep Singh, Mohammad Shami, Varun Chakaravarthy, Ravi Bishnoi, Washington Sundar, Dhruv Jurel (wk).
